About Libo Qin
Libo Qin is a scholar working on Artificial Intelligence, Computer Vision and Pattern Recognition, Information Systems, Molecular Biology and Organic Chemistry, having authored 59 papers that have together received 1.0k indexed citations. Recurring topics across this work include Topic Modeling (38 papers), Natural Language Processing Techniques (27 papers), Speech and dialogue systems (19 papers), Multimodal Machine Learning Applications (15 papers), Text Readability and Simplification (4 papers), Sentiment Analysis and Opinion Mining (3 papers), Domain Adaptation and Few-Shot Learning (3 papers) and Advanced Text Analysis Techniques (3 papers). The work is most often cited by research in Artificial Intelligence (904 citations), Computer Vision and Pattern Recognition (199 citations), Health Informatics (8 citations), Information Systems (53 citations) and Management Science and Operations Research (20 citations). Libo Qin has collaborated with scholars based in China, Singapore and United States. Frequent co-authors include Wanxiang Che, Yangming Li, Ting Liu, Haoyang Wen, Minheng Ni, Ting Liu, Xu Xiao, Ting Liu, Yue Zhang and Sendong Zhao. Their work appears in journals such as IEEE/ACM Transactions on Audio Speech and Language Processing, Patterns, Nature Communications, Frontiers of Computer Science and Big Data Mining and Analytics.
